Thursday, January 6, 2005 Earthquake
The earthquake hit Mexico on Thursday, January 6, 2005 at 00:02 UTC with a magnitude of 5.7. The closest known location in the current dataset is Cabo San Lucas (Mexico - MX), about 378.6 km away. The epicenter is located at longitude -109.111 and latitude 19.573.
